Transaction 075193515bfb9c21164e2341165d847ec155cf31c3f255573489145c6a61a848

1 Input
2 Outputs
  • 075193515bfb9c21164e2341165d847ec155cf31c3f255573489145c6a61a848:0
  • value  999940000
    address  1PGC9VphRWbNnLorh3aGK6TNYpUmZtw1DD
  • 075193515bfb9c21164e2341165d847ec155cf31c3f255573489145c6a61a848:1
  • value  2000055968
    address  3DCWQ6zhqKqB51Rt6EoempwXzDV3wpTqU8